CI note for Ledgerlens diff viewer. The large-file rendering tests occasionally time out on shared runners because the 200MB fixture is regenerated per job. Use the cached fixture bucket instead; the setup step does this automatically if the cache key matches. If you see a checksum mismatch, clear the cache and rerun once before investigating further. Always include the build identifier shown below in your report.

session token of tajef-bageg = htk21_5d90d574934f3ccae6437

Handover note — Crumbwheel order cutoffs.

Welcome aboard. The bakery cutoff rule in Crumbwheel closes same-day orders at 14:00 local to each storefront, not UTC — this has bitten us twice. Holiday overrides live in the calendar service and take precedence silently, so always check there first when a cutoff looks wrong. To unlock the calendar service's admin console after a restart, enter the recovery passphrase below.

vault phrase of bagap-bahaf = silion-pelox-sorox-casdor-quenwyn-fraax-eliox-praael-kelion-quenvan-kasox-rusael-norius-belvan

## Changelog — Glacierbox 3.2.0

Renamed `GB_ARCHIVE_KEY` to `GB_COLDSTORE_TOKEN`. The old name still works but logs a deprecation warning; it will be removed in 4.0. The token authorizes bucket freeze and thaw operations against the Frostvault backend. Update any `.env` files on archiver hosts before upgrading — the migration script does not rename variables for you. After removing the old entry, add the new one on its own line:

vault entry, kagep-yajeg: COURIER_KEY5=da097

Action item from the Mirewater tide-table widget incident. Owner: release manager. Widget cached stale harbor offsets after the DST change, showing tides six hours off for two days. Required: add a cache-invalidation check to the release checklist, block deploys when offset tables are older than 24 hours, and verify the Saltgate harbor feed before each cut. Deadline: next release. Checklist template and sign-off procedure are documented on the internal page below.

wiki page, kawif-bajep: https://artifactory.zarqelforge.internal/issue/browse/display/display/projects/spaces/secrets/000fe6ec5a46af29355003e1